    • An apparatus includes a first connector and a member. The first connector connects a first tubing section and a second tubing section together. The member is adapted to be moved from a retracted to an extended position to form a sealed connection between a first tubular member that is connected to the first tubing section and a second tubular member that is connected to the second tubing section. In another embodiment of the invention, an apparatus includes a first connector and a member. The first connector forms a connection between a first tubing section and the second tubing section and leaves a gap between a first end of a first tubular member that is connected to the first tubing section and a second end of a second tubular member that is connected to the second tubing section. The member is inserted into the gap to seal the first tubular member and the second tubular member together. In another embodiment of the invention, an apparatus includes a pin end that includes a first passageway in communication with a first tubular member and a second passageway in communication with a first tubing section. The apparatus also includes a box end that is adapted to receive a pin end. The box end includes a third passageway that is in communication with a second tubular member and a fourth passageway that is in communication with a second tubing section. The apparatus includes a locking mechanism to secure the pin end and the box end together.

    • A memory device that accurately tracks memory operations includes a vertical loopback for tracking a sense clock signal to a row address decoder, and read and write reference bit lines in a reference column that include loopbacks for vertically tracking a selected bit line during read and write operations. Preferably the widths of word lines and a sense line are equal to enable the sense line to horizontally track any selected word line. The memory device also includes tri-state input/output (I/O) latches to latch sense amplifier outputs. A drive circuit of the tri-state I/O latch is disabled when the output is available at the corresponding sense amplifier and enabled when the output is latched by the latch circuit.

    • In general, the subject matter described in this specification can be embodied in methods, systems, and program products for monitoring application program resource consumption. Information that identifies consumption, by multiple computing devices and at requests of a particular application program, of resources that correspond to the computing devices is accessed. Each of the multiple computing devices provided a portion of the information. The accessed information is analyzed by a computing system to determine one or more values that identify consumption of the resources by at least a subset of the computing devices. An indicium that illustrates the one or more values is provided for display on a particular computing device and in cooperation with a display of a network-accessible application program software marketplace. The application program software marketplace provides application program software for execution by the particular computing device and other computing devices.

    • A connector guard is provided to protect one or both downhole connectors during wellbore run in prior to mating downhole. The connector guard may comprise dissolvable or degradable material and include an engagement sections and a removal feature. The connector guard may be dissolved or degraded via a reactive agent or temperature either introduced downhole proximate to the guards or contained within a chamber included in or created by a connector guard. The connector guard may be further coupled by a non-reactive cover in order to control the rate of reaction of the dissolvable material. The cover may be breached prior to mating of the downhole connectors.

    • A method includes receiving a request to install a software release, where the software release is to be installed on a first device and/or a second device. The method also includes initiating installation of the software release on the second device and determining whether or not a user wishes to continue with the installation of the software release. The method further includes initiating installation of the software release on the first device if the user wishes to continue. In addition, the method includes restoring a second software release on the second device if the user does not wish to continue. The first and second devices may represent redundant devices, such as a redundant set of controllers in a process control system or a redundant set of I/O modules that facilitate communication between one or more controllers and one or more process elements in the process control system.
